
Team Bella vs. Team B.A.D. vs. PCB: Winner and Reaction from 2015 WWE SummerSlam
Team Bella's stranglehold on the WWE Divas division was loosened even more Sunday night at SummerSlam after PCB was victorious in a three-team elimination match.

PCB's Paige, Charlotte and Becky Lynch as well as Team B.A.D.—comprised of Sasha Banks, Naomi and Tamina Snuka—entered SummerSlam in hopes injecting new life into the Divas division, and the former did that by knocking off both Team B.A.D. and the team of Nikki Bella, Brie Bella and Alicia Fox.
Divas champion Nikki Bella has dominated the women's wrestling landscape for nearly 300 days, but she was finally met with a challenge when Stephanie McMahon called Charlotte, Becky and Sasha up from NXT to lead a "Divas Revolution."
That has resulted in Divas wrestling becoming a central part of WWE programming over the past several weeks. All nine women are receiving plenty of time both in the ring and on the mic, as most shows have featured two Divas matches in addition to backstage segments and commentary spots meant to get their characters over.
The three factions are different in many ways, but they have jelled together quite effectively, which has allowed every Diva in the angle to shine.
With that said, there is little doubt the three new call-ups have captivated fans most. Charlotte, Becky and Sasha have all been protected well in terms of booking, and they all look like legitimate contenders for the Divas Championship moving forward.

The Divas Championship wasn't up for grabs Sunday, but it was once again abundantly clear that Nikki and Team Bella will have their hands full moving forward, especially after suffering another loss.
Most of the nine Divas who have been placed in the Divas Revolution are absolutely deserving of holding the Divas Championship in the near future, and it is entirely possible a new champion will be crowned at next month's Night of Champions event.
SummerSlam was more about allowing everyone to show what they can do and proving that Divas wrestling is very much on the ascent in WWE.
The overall performance was far more important than the result, and it is difficult to argue against the notion that all three teams laid it on the line and put on a show that furthered the Divas Revolution.
There is still plenty of work to be done when it comes to making women's wrestling the best it can be in WWE, but there is little doubt things are on the right track following the highly entertaining bout at SummerSlam.
